Moving from a dorm to an apartment? Make sure you have these 5 essentials

If you plan to make any warm beverage, having a kettle is essential. Photo by HG Biggs.
  1. Can opener: When I went to Walmart with my mom shortly before moving into my apartment, she asked me if I had a can opener. I did not and would not have thought to pick one up had she not mentioned it. You’re going to need a can opener eventually, no matter how little you cook, so make sure you have one in one of your kitchen drawers for when you inevitably get a cold or stomach bug and need to open a can of soup.
  2. Drain snake and drain cleaner: Having a clogged sink or bathtub with no way to fix the problem is a frustrating experience. While most apartment complexes have a maintenance request portal, maintenance workers often take several days to complete the request. You don’t want to have to shower in a tub filled with scummy water or brush your teeth in a sink that won’t drain.
  3. One pot, one pan, one bowl: I do almost all of my cooking with one pot, one pan and one bowl. These three items are the bare essentials for a kitchen that many people likely did not buy when living in campus dorms. Whether you have a campus meal plan or not, make no mistake, you will eventually want to use the kitchen in your new apartment.
  4. Swiffer Wetjet or similar product: Unless you want to constantly be walking around on all the dirt you track onto your floor from Oxford, you’ll need some sort of mop.
  5. Electric kettle or microwave safe kettle: Do you drink tea? Instant coffee? Live off of instant noodles like many college students? Then you’ll need to be able to boil water. Boiling water on a stovetop doesn’t take long, but having an electric kettle or one that you can heat up in the microwave further speeds up the process. I use my microwave kettle daily for tea and on nights that I don’t have the energy to make anything other than a cup of Maruchan instant ramen.
